What about meals in packets? Take sheets of foil and layer thinly sliced veg on the bottom of the packet and lay the meat/fish over the top with herbs and seasonings on top, close the foil over the top, bringing the edges together in the middle and seal the top and sides by rolling up the foil and putting them on the bbq? Grilled romaine Caesar salads--take the heads of romaine, cut in half length wise and grill the cut edges until lightly charred, and proceed as you would with a (paleo) Caesar salad. Terresa Posted July 18, 2013 Share Posted July 18, 2013 Most meats can be bbq'ed, as Spinspin says. And foil pockets of veggies are awesome! I do pockets of 4 veggies, and change up exactly which veggies and herbs each day. I double-foil the veggies and do the meat separately, since cooking times don't always match up. Both ghee and coconut oil work as fats in the pockets. I have carrots, yams, turnips, parsnips, leeks, onions, asparagus, brussels sprouts, zucchini, and mushrooms as regulars on hand, and add whatever else strikes my fancy for variety.
